This file may be modified by the user, subject to the additional terms of the license agreement. @par Specification Reference: **/ #ifndef _USB4_CS_IO_H_ #define _USB4_CS_IO_H_ #include #include #include typedef struct _USB4_CS_IO USB4_CS_IO; // // USB4_CS_IO functions // /** Reads register data with a given address from USB4 config space. Operation: 1. Prepare the read request 2. Swap bytes 3. Calculate CRC and swap it too 4. Read response and swap bytes of response data @param[in] This - Pointer to USB4_CS_IO function table. @param[in] TopologyId - Pointer to Topology ID of Router. @param[in] ConfigSpace - Configuration space to be read. @param[in] AdpNum - Adapter number. @param[in] Offset - Data offset in the config space. @param[in] Count - DWORD count to be read from config space. @param[out] Data - Data buffer for Read data. @param[out] RspAdpNum - Pointer to the response adapter number (Required for TBT3 compatible operations). @retval EFI_SUCCESS - USB4 config space register read success. @retval EFI_UNSUPPORTED - Fail to read USB4 config space register. @retval EFI_INVALID_PARAMETER - Invalid parameter. **/ typedef EFI_STATUS (* USB4_CS_IO_READ) ( IN USB4_CS_IO *This, IN PTOPOLOGY_ID TopologyId, IN USB4_CONFIG_SPACE ConfigSpace, IN UINT8 AdpNum, IN UINT16 Offset, IN UINT8 Count, OUT UINT32 *Data, OUT UINT8 *RspAdpNum ); /** Write data to a given register in USB4 config space Operation: 1. Prepare the write request 2. Swap bytes 3. Calculate CRC and swap it @param[in] This - Pointer to USB4_CS_IO function table. @param[in] TopologyId - Pointer to Topology ID of Router. @param[in] ConfigSpace - Configuration space to be written. @param[in] AdpNum - Adapter number @param[in] Offset - Data offset in the config space. @param[in] Count - DWORD count to be written to config space. @param[in] Data - Data buffer for USB4 config space read. @retval EFI_SUCCESS - Write data to USB4 register successfully. @retval EFI_UNSUPPORTED - Fail to read USB4 config space register. @retval EFI_INVALID_PARAMETER - Invalid parameter. **/ typedef EFI_STATUS (* USB4_CS_IO_WRITE) ( IN USB4_CS_IO *This, IN PTOPOLOGY_ID TopologyId, IN USB4_CONFIG_SPACE ConfigSpace, IN UINT8 AdpNum, IN UINT16 Offset, IN UINT8 Count, IN UINT32 *Data ); /** Query Upstream Adapter number of Router. Used for TBT3 compatible operations. @param[in] This - Pointer to USB4_CS_IO instance. @param[in] TopologyId - Pointer to Topology ID of Router. @param[out] UpAdpNum - Pointer to Upstream Adapter number. @retval EFI_SUCCESS - Query Upstream Adapter number success. @retval other - Query Upstream Adapter number failure. **/ typedef EFI_STATUS (* USB4_CS_IO_QUERY_RT_UP_ADAPTER) ( IN USB4_CS_IO *This, IN PTOPOLOGY_ID TopologyId, OUT UINT8 *UpAdpNum ); /** Increment reference count to host interface core. The host interface core can't be released if the reference count is non-zero. @param[in] This - Pointer to USB4_CS_IO function table. **/ typedef VOID (* USB4_CS_IO_ADD_REF) ( IN USB4_CS_IO *This ); /** Decrement reference count to host interface core. The host interface core can't be released if the reference count is non-zero. @param[in] This - Pointer to USB4_CS_IO function table. **/ typedef VOID (* USB4_CS_IO_RELEASE_REF) ( IN USB4_CS_IO *This ); // // Function table for USB4 config space access // struct _USB4_CS_IO { USB4_CS_IO_READ CsRead; USB4_CS_IO_WRITE CsWrite; USB4_CS_IO_QUERY_RT_UP_ADAPTER QueryRtUpAdp; USB4_CS_IO_ADD_REF AddRef; USB4_CS_IO_RELEASE_REF ReleaseRef; }; #endif
